Housing costs in Mexico?
A typical home costs $134,400, which is 60.2% less expensive than the national average of $338,100 and 36.7% less expensive than the average Missouri home, at $212,300. Renting a two-bedroom unit in Mexico costs $780 per month, which is 45.5% cheaper than the national average of $1,430 and 21.8% cheaper than the state average of $950.

Can I afford Mexico?
To live comfortably in Mexico, Missouri, a minimum annual income of $25,920 for a family, and $24,800 for a single person is recommended.
